Stephen Wilson+FollowTara Moore’s Ban: Justice or Overkill?Big news in British tennis: Tara Moore, once the country’s top doubles ace, just got hit with a four-year ban after a doping appeal—even though she was cleared by an independent tribunal last year. The Cas ruling says Moore couldn’t prove the positive test was from contaminated meat, overturning her earlier exoneration.
